THE ROLE
As a Business Intelligence Analyst, you will analyze data to uncover trends and insights related to customer behavior, sales, inventory, and website traffic. You will develop customer journey maps, track key performance indicators, and create reports and dashboards to provide actionable recommendations for business success. By leveraging predictive models, you will forecast sales and customer behavior, optimizing strategies for inventory, marketing, and product management. Additionally, you will collaborate with UX/UI teams to implement data-driven improvements, enhancing customer experiences and increasing engagement and conversion rates.
Responsibilities
Analyze data to identify trends, patterns, and insights related to customer behavior, sales, inventory, and website traffic.
Develop customer journey maps for various segments, illustrating paths from initial contact to final purchase.
Create reports and dashboards highlighting KPIs, insights, and business trends.
Define and track necessary analytics, providing actionable recommendations for team success.
Develop predictive models to forecast sales and customer behavior for optimizing inventory, marketing, and product strategies.
Optimize marketing campaigns and website layouts using data-driven insights.
Conduct A/B testing to enhance website conversion rates and customer engagement.
Collaborate with UX/UI teams to implement data-driven improvements for a smoother customer journey.
Leverage insights to optimize marketing channels and increase engagement and conversion rates.
Monitor the impact of changes and continuously test to improve user experience and outcomes.
Ensure compliance with data privacy laws and enforce data governance and security policies.
Stay updated with industry trends and explore new tools and sources to enhance data analysis capabilities.
Monitor website performance daily and set up automated alerts for any significant issues.
Provide rapid response analyses and recommendations to address shifts or problems in site performance.
Skills & Experience
Strong analytical skills with experience in e-commerce data analysis, including customer behavior, sales, inventory, and website traffic.
Expertise in developing customer journey maps and reporting KPIs and business trends using tools like Google Analytics, Power BI, or Tableau.
Proficient in predictive modeling and optimizing marketing campaigns, inventory, and website layouts based on data-driven insights.
Experience with A/B testing, conversion rate optimization, and collaborating with UX/UI teams to enhance user experience.
Familiarity with data privacy laws and best practices for data governance and security.
Skilled in setting up automated performance monitoring and alerts for site issues or metric shifts.
Ability to stay updated with the latest industry trends and continuously improve data analysis processes and tools.
